Free Rider Problem
A situation in which individuals consume more than their fair share of a public resource, or shoulder less of the cost of its provision, thereby taking advantage of others' contributions.
Anti-Competitive
Practices that reduce or prevent competition in a market, leading to less favorable conditions for consumers.
Nash Equilibrium
A concept in game theory where no player can benefit by changing their strategy while others keep theirs unchanged.
